The number of potential jurors that can be excused by the prosecution varies depending on the jurisdiction and the specific case. Generally, prosecution can use "peremptory challenges" to excuse a limited number of jurors without giving a reason, which is typically between 3 to 10 jurors in most cases. Additionally, they can challenge jurors for cause, which does not have a set limit. Overall, the exact number can differ based on local laws and the type of trial.
